Output 6c63762de509bb5f677e3d688038951e2adff4cacd9adb440016024f4805ea68:240

value
2780330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81800c1e667be928f607c55797dd653ccafda31c OP_EQUAL
address
3DVkVB6oc4qeuBjev9tvcDd4sR22E3j3eW
transaction
6c63762de509bb5f677e3d688038951e2adff4cacd9adb440016024f4805ea68
confirmations
339540
spent
true